Hey my ole friend I have run nitro in my Jr fuel dragster & in my racing karts. First let me ask you some questions. How what % of nitro are you trying to run? What oil are running? & what percent are you running. No one runs 100% nitro in a 2 stroke, so I hope you are not trying to do that. 25% is alot for a two stroke. Even in my dragster I kept it no more than 50% even though some guys ran more, they also blew up a lot of engines. Also you do not have to run over 20 to 1 oil mix. Remember your fuel to air mixture is under 7 to 1 with nitro & alky, so you are already getting plenty of oil at that mix. Just things to consider. Remember also mixing oil heavy fuel makes for heavy viscosity & screws up fuel flow & setting. Hope this helps.

I love your channel! Amazing what a dedicated individual can do. Congrats on making it your full time job! I suggest a spring loaded chain tensioner. If you maximize the wrap around the small sprocket, you can transmit more torque. Also have a spring loaded tensioner would greatly reduce the swing in the long chain in between pushing/pulling phases. And please, put a guard between you and any moving part. If the chain snaps it could really cripple you!
